Frequently asked questions
Will a hard reset delete everything on my BLU C4?
Yes. A hard reset (also called a factory reset) erases all apps, photos, messages, and accounts, returning the BLU C4 to its out-of-box state. Back up anything you want to keep before starting.
Does resetting the BLU C4 remove the SIM lock or carrier lock?
No. A hard or factory reset only clears data and settings — it doesn't remove a carrier/SIM lock, which is tied to the device's IMEI at the network level. You'd need to contact your carrier for an unlock.
How long does a factory reset take on the BLU C4?
Typically a few minutes, though it can take longer on older or heavily used devices as more stored data has to be wiped.
Will I need my Google account password after resetting the BLU C4?
Yes, if Factory Reset Protection (FRP) is enabled. Android (and HarmonyOS 2.x devices with Google services) will ask for the last signed-in Google account after a reset — make sure you know that password first.
